  • @JoshitoBonso You could use them during MMA training (in your water?). Average dosage is 2 - 4 capsules (depending on brand) of approx 3000 mg of Leucine, Isoleucine, and Valine combination. In a 1.5 hour workout, you could do the dosage before and during (whole protein after). However, I wouldn't recommend lifting on an empty stomach - cardio can be fine tho. If fat loss is your goal, use whole-food source of clean carbs post workout. Skip the Powerade, HFCS is nasty! Thanks for watching!! :)

  • Basically it sets up an environment where it's extremely likely that your body will use the free flowing BCAA for energy, much like it would if it broke down muscle for free flowing BCAA's. There's a theory that suggests a higher concentration of BCAA's in the blood signals the body that muscle has ALREADY broken down, and therefore can "encourage" the body to use and alternative source -- fat. The body is so dynamic, but we try to create a picture of how it works, the best we can :) Thannks!

  • From Charles Poliquin, the famous strength coach:

    "I recommend taking 0.44 g per Kg of bodyweight. Take half of this dosage within 30 minutes before training. Take the other half right after training. E.g., f you weigh 90 kilograms (198 lbs), take 40 grams of branch chain amino acids. Using this type of dosage, it is not uncommon for some of my clients to gain 9 lbs of lean body mass in just 3 weeks using this protocol."
